ZINC oxide ,POLYVINYL alcohol ,NANOFLUIDS ,NANOPARTICLES ,SPEED of ultrasonic waves - Abstract
Crystalline zinc oxide nanoparticles are synthesized using salvo-thermal process and its nanofluids are prepared by the dispersion of nanoparticles in PVA solution. The prepared nanoparticles are characterized using X-ray diffraction (XRD), Scanning electron microscopy (SEM), Fourier Transform-Infrared spectroscopy (FT-IR) and UV--visible Techniques. The ultrasonic velocities are measured in the synthesized nanofluid at different temperatures and for different concentration of ZnO in PVA using ultrasonic interferometer. Also, the densities of the nanofluid are measured at different concentrations of ZnO in the PVA at room temperature. From the measured values of Ultrasonic velocity and density, acoustical parameters such as adiabatic compressibility, acoustic impedance, intermolecular free length, surface tension were calculated to understand the solute-solvent interaction in a polymer solution.
